Chief Advisor Dr. Muhammad Yunus expressed strong optimism regarding the upcoming 13th parliamentary elections scheduled for February, predicting that the event will be "peaceful and festive" and a source of national pride.

Dr. Yunus made these remarks while speaking at the closing ceremony of the National Defence Course (NDC) and Armed Forces War Course-2025 at Mirpur Cantonment on Wednesday (December 3rd) morning.

He stated that the nation would be proud of this "historic election." Addressing the course graduates, Dr. Yunus emphasized that the knowledge and experience gained will be instrumental in national development, policy-making, and strategic decision-making. He praised the National Defence College for establishing itself as a center of excellence in security and development studies, noting its role in creating efficient leadership to handle rapidly changing national and international challenges.

The Chief Advisor acknowledged and appreciated the crucial role the Armed Forces play in the country's security and disaster management. Dr. Yunus concluded his speech by seeking prayers from the public for the health of Begum Khaleda Zia.

The statement by Chief Advisor Dr. Muhammad Yunus on December 3, 2025, serves as the most recent update concerning the government's outlook on the electoral process. His assurance of a "peaceful and festive" atmosphere sets the official tone as the country prepares for the 13th parliamentary elections in the coming months.
